Buying Guide
What to check before buying
- Horsepower and RPM: Most 1/6 HP motors run around 1075–810 RPM. Confirm your condenser fan’s required speed and horsepower.
- Voltage and amperage: Ensure the motor voltage matches your system (208–230V) and that the current draw is compatible with the control board or relay wiring.
- Capacitor compatibility: Many motors require a 5 μF capacitor; verify your existing capacitor or plan to replace with a matching unit.
- Rotation direction: Some motors offer CW or CCW rotation or reversible options. Match the shaft end and rotation to your existing setup.
- Footprint and shaft: Check motor diameter, shaft diameter, and mounting pattern to fit the condenser housing and blower assembly.
Direct replacement or upgrade?
If your goal is a straightforward swap with minimal changes, prioritize OEM-replacement parts that match your model numbers. For new equipment installations or legacy units with limited compatibility, a versatile motor with reversible rotation and included capacitor can simplify future replacements.
Maintenance considerations
- Lubrication: Most modern condenser motors are sealed and maintenance-free; avoid adding lubricant.
- Ventilation and heat: Ensure adequate condenser airflow; restricted airflow increases motor temperature and shortens life.
- Coil cleanliness: Clean condenser coils before installation to maximize efficiency and prevent motor overload.
FAQ
- Q: Do all 1/6 HP condenser motors fit the same openings?
- A: Not always; verify diameter, shaft size, and mounting pattern against your unit’s specifications.
- Q: Can I reuse my old capacitor?
- A: It’s generally best to replace with the specified capacitor to ensure proper startup torque and reliability.
- Q: Is a reversible rotation motor necessary?
- A: Only if your system requires a specific rotation; otherwise, standard CW rotation is common.
- Q: How do I know which motor is the right replacement for Goodman or Janitrol?
- A: Compare OEM numbers, voltage, speed (RPM), and fitting dimensions; OEM replacements minimize wiring and mounting changes.
